(Lois McMaster Bujold) Negotiating a salary at a new job - really negotiating Negotiating is the art of getting what you want while giving up what you want less. A good recruiter can help you negotiate. He can find out all the details before the offer is given to you and get important problems fixed. He can give away the things you care less about. He can negotiate for you before the final offer is put on the table. A good recruiter can put pressure on a company that you will never see. If you have a recruiter be blunt and honest with him. Don't lie and say I need $80,000 when you are hoping for $60,000. Tell the recruiter the truth. Then accept or reject an offer based on its merits, not on your greed for more. If you don't have a recruiter, you have to do exactly the same thing, only directly with someone at the company.
Every one of those points is about communication. Negotiating a salary is about communicating. Go at it with the desire to understand and inform and you will come out ahead.
